How much does it cost to rent a home in Stephen Knolls?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Stephen Knolls 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,100 | $2,100 | $2,100 |
| Stephen Knolls 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,997 | $2,995 | $3,000 |
| Stephen Knolls 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,289 | $3,100 | $3,450 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Stephen Knolls
What type of rentals are currently available in Stephen Knolls?
There are currently 33 Apartments for Rent in Stephen Knolls, MD with pricing that ranges from $1,525 to $3,893. There are also 17 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Stephen Knolls ranging from $1,800 to $3,450.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Stephen Knolls?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Stephen Knolls ranges from $1,800 to $3,450 with an average monthly rent of $2,596.
